Nutrient balance — Cropland phosphorus per unit area in Argentina
Argentina: Nutrient balance — Cropland phosphorus per unit area was -1.94 kg/ha in 2023. ▼ Falling
Nutrient balance — Cropland phosphorus per unit area in Argentina, 1961–2023
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in kg/ha.
Analysis
Argentina recorded -1.94 kg/ha for nutrient balance — cropland phosphorus per unit area in 2023.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 67.2% on the previous year and up 66.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, nutrient balance — cropland phosphorus per unit area in Argentina peaked at -1.24 kg/ha in 1968 and was at its lowest, -9.63 kg/ha, in 2015.
Argentina ranks 172nd of 201 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 63 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| -1.9 kg/ha | -2.89 kg/ha | -1.24 kg/ha | 9 |
| 1970s | -2.41 kg/ha | -3.65 kg/ha | -1.39 kg/ha | 10 |
| 1980s | -3.88 kg/ha | -4.92 kg/ha | -2.27 kg/ha | 10 |
| 1990s | -4.05 kg/ha | -5.05 kg/ha | -2.08 kg/ha | 10 |
| 2000s | -5.16 kg/ha | -7.48 kg/ha | -3.14 kg/ha | 10 |
| 2010s | -6.48 kg/ha | -9.63 kg/ha | -4.43 kg/ha | 10 |
| 2020s | -4.7 kg/ha | -5.92 kg/ha | -1.94 kg/ha | 4 |

About this data
The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
